A Snapshot of Your Day

As a Strategic Procurement Specialist, you will be part of the StrategicProcurement team, grounded with the goal of optimizing our supply chain tominimize costs and maximize risk mitigation. You will oversee and manageprojects that contribute to cost savings, second sourcing, and controllingpricing for various commodities and suppliers. Along with that, you willsupport other departments within Trench Canada such as Engineering/R&D andQuality with supplier-related tasks as well assupportingoperationsfor strategies to resolve part shortages.

Your Tasks:
  • Develop and Implement Commodity strategies to generate value and to minimize the overall cost and ensure reliable on-time supply of materials in the required quality to create a strong competitive advantage.
  • Drive Supplier Management process including contract negotiation, qualification, selection, evaluation, classification, development and claim management, to develop the best suppliers and ensure transparency.
  • Independently prepare and carry out negotiations with suppliers around the world.
  • Lead, implement or support complex supply chain projects for risk mitigation and future sustainability.
  • Understand in detail the cost structure of their commodity in detail for cost control and negotiations and identify improvement potentials.
  • Implement and ensure usage of defined methods processes and systems (e.g., compliant to Purchase-to-Pay (P2P) process, Procurement Guidelines, IT systems and compliance).
  • Align strategies and ensure close cooperation with internal customers such as Engineering, R&D, Production, Quality, as well as with other global factories.
Requirements:
  • Bachelor's degree in engineering, with at least 10 years of industry experience in procurement, contract management and supplier management.
  • Specialized knowledge of some specific commodities such as Insulators, Machined Parts, Sheet Metal parts, Conductive material, Electronics etc.
  • Expert in vendor lifecycle management including implementing KPIs, KRIs and vendor workflows.
  • Working knowledge of purchasing fundamentals including RFQs, strong ability to apply classic and advanced negotiation methods (e.g., e-Auction), Incoterms 2020 knowledge etc.
  • Demonstrate high-level expertise in SAP. Experience in using E-Sourcing tool such as Ariba is considered an asset.
  • Advanced Microsoft capabilities (Excel, PowerPoint, Word).
  • Strong collaboration, persuasion/influencing abilities with project management skills, and the ability to drive supplier/product change projects within a cross-functional team.
  • Ability to access priorities, demonstrate flexibility and understand the sense of urgency.
  • Ability to read and understand technical drawings and specifications.
